Web6 jun. 2024 · A monthly pass for TransLink costs between $100.25 to $181.05, depending on the number of zones you require. A car, on the other hand, will likely cost you much … Web24 mrt. 2024 · It would cost roughly $1,367 dollars a month for a single person to live in Prince George. That's quite a contrast compared to the $1,831 needed in North Vancouver. With the average home price at around $407,000 in Prince George, residents pay roughly half for housing than their neighbors in other British Columbia communities.
